When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Fátima?
Good weather’s always better when you’re experiencing new places, so here’s a little information about the seasons: The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 69°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 51°F. Average annual precipitation for Fátima is 34 inches.
What is there to see and do in Fátima?
Depending on what you’re interested in, you might appreciate the area around Fátima. Get out into nature with places like Mira de Aire Caves, Grutas de Alvados & Grutas de Santo António, and Natural Park of Aire and Candeeiros Mountains. Cultural attractions include Apparitions Museum, Museu de Cera, and Battle of Aljubarrota Interpretation Centre. Visit landmarks like Sanctuary of Our Lady of Fatima, Monumento Natural das Pegadas de Dinossaurios da Serra de Aire, and Castle of Ourem.
